Searched refs:skip_serializing_if (Results 1 - 12 of 12) sorted by relevance
/third_party/rust/crates/cxx/macro/src/ |
H A D | clang.rs | 17 #[serde(skip_serializing_if = "Option::is_none")] 23 #[serde(skip_serializing_if = "Option::is_none")] 27 skip_serializing_if = "Option::is_none" 46 #[serde(rename = "desugaredQualType", skip_serializing_if = "Option::is_none")]
|
/third_party/rust/crates/syn/json/src/ |
H A D | lib.rs | 88 skip_serializing_if = "is_private", 93 #[serde(skip_serializing_if = "is_true", default = "bool_true")]
|
/third_party/rust/crates/serde/test_suite/tests/ui/malformed/ |
H A D | trailing_expr.rs | 5 #[serde(skip_serializing_if, x.is_empty())]
|
/third_party/rust/crates/serde/test_suite/tests/ui/with-variant/ |
H A D | skip_ser_struct_field_if.rs | 7 #[serde(skip_serializing_if = "always")]
|
H A D | skip_ser_newtype_field_if.rs | 6 Newtype(#[serde(skip_serializing_if = "always")] String),
|
H A D | skip_ser_tuple_field_if.rs | 6 Tuple(#[serde(skip_serializing_if = "always")] String, u8),
|
/third_party/rust/crates/serde/serde_derive/src/ |
H A D | ser.rs | 271 .map(|(i, field)| match field.attrs.skip_serializing_if() { in serialize_tuple_struct() 335 .map(|field| match field.attrs.skip_serializing_if() { in serialize_struct_as_struct() 377 .map(|field| match field.attrs.skip_serializing_if() { in serialize_struct_as_map() 838 .map(|(i, field)| match field.attrs.skip_serializing_if() { in serialize_tuple_variant() 918 match field.attrs.skip_serializing_if() { in serialize_struct_variant() 1086 .skip_serializing_if() in serialize_tuple_struct_visitor() 1129 .skip_serializing_if() in serialize_struct_visitor()
|
/third_party/rust/crates/serde/serde_derive_internals/src/ |
H A D | attr.rs | 1038 skip_serializing_if: Option<syn::ExprPath>, 1083 let mut skip_serializing_if = Attr::none(cx, SKIP_SERIALIZING_IF); in from_ast() variables 1162 // #[serde(skip_serializing_if = "...")] in from_ast() 1164 skip_serializing_if.set(&meta.path, path); in from_ast() 1305 skip_serializing_if: skip_serializing_if.get(), in from_ast() 1346 pub fn skip_serializing_if(&self) -> Option<&syn::ExprPath> { in skip_serializing_if() functions 1347 self.skip_serializing_if.as_ref() in skip_serializing_if()
|
H A D | check.rs | 257 if field.attrs.skip_serializing_if().is_some() { in check_variant_skip_attrs() 261 "variant `{}` cannot have both #[serde(serialize_with)] and a field {} marked with #[serde(skip_serializing_if)]", in check_variant_skip_attrs()
|
/third_party/rust/crates/serde/serde_derive/src/internals/ |
H A D | attr.rs | 1038 skip_serializing_if: Option<syn::ExprPath>, 1083 let mut skip_serializing_if = Attr::none(cx, SKIP_SERIALIZING_IF); in from_ast() variables 1162 // #[serde(skip_serializing_if = "...")] in from_ast() 1164 skip_serializing_if.set(&meta.path, path); in from_ast() 1305 skip_serializing_if: skip_serializing_if.get(), in from_ast() 1346 pub fn skip_serializing_if(&self) -> Option<&syn::ExprPath> { in skip_serializing_if() functions 1347 self.skip_serializing_if.as_ref() in skip_serializing_if()
|
H A D | check.rs | 257 if field.attrs.skip_serializing_if().is_some() { in check_variant_skip_attrs() 261 "variant `{}` cannot have both #[serde(serialize_with)] and a field {} marked with #[serde(skip_serializing_if)]", in check_variant_skip_attrs()
|
/third_party/rust/crates/serde/test_suite/tests/ |
H A D | test_annotations.rs | 814 #[serde(skip_serializing_if = "ShouldSkip::should_skip")] 858 #[serde(skip_serializing_if = "ShouldSkip::should_skip")] C, 937 #[serde(skip_serializing_if = "ShouldSkip::should_skip")] 943 #[serde(skip_serializing_if = "ShouldSkip::should_skip")] C,
|
Completed in 12 milliseconds